Frequency Guidelines for Commercial Roof Cleaning

Cleaning commercial roofs is an essential aspect of maintenance that ensures the longevity and functionality of the roofing system. As of 2025, the frequency of cleaning commercial roofs can vary based on several factors, including the type of roofing material, the architecture of the building, and environmental conditions. However, a general guideline suggests that commercial roofs should typically be cleaned at least once or twice a year. This frequency allows for the removal of debris, algae, moss, and accumulated dirt, which can otherwise lead to roof deterioration and potential leaks.

Regular cleaning not only enhances the aesthetic appeal of the building but also plays a crucial role in maintaining the roof’s warranty and overall performance. Many manufacturers require regular maintenance as a condition of the warranty, which may include documented cleaning schedules. Therefore, adhering to cleaning guidelines contributes to the protection of the investment in the roofing system and helps to avoid costly repairs down the line.

Factors Influencing Roof Cleaning Frequency

When considering the cleaning frequency for commercial roofs, several factors come into play that influence how often a roof should be maintained. These factors include the type of roof material, the geographical location and climate, the surrounding environment, and the level of foot traffic or equipment placed on the roof. The roof’s material is crucial because different materials have various degrees of susceptibility to dirt, algae, moss, and other debris. For instance, a flat roof may accumulate dirt and standing water more quickly than a sloped roof, thus requiring more frequent cleaning.

Geographical location also plays a significant role in determining cleaning frequency. In areas with high rainfall or humidity, roofs may develop mold and algae more rapidly, necessitating more regular maintenance. Conversely, in drier climates, dust and debris can accumulate, but the growth of biological contaminants may be less of a concern. Additionally, commercial buildings located near bodies of water, industrial sites, or agricultural areas may experience higher levels of debris due to environmental factors, such as bird droppings, leaf litter, and other pollutants, which can influence how often the roof should be cleaned.

The level of foot traffic or the presence of rooftop equipment can also impact cleaning frequency. Roofs that are frequently accessed for maintenance, HVAC units, or other installations may require more frequent cleaning due to the wear and tear caused by equipment and personnel moving across them. Furthermore, regular inspections may be necessary to ensure that any debris buildup is cleared away to avoid damage or liability.

Seasonal Considerations for Roof Maintenance

Seasonal considerations play a crucial role in determining the maintenance schedule for commercial roofs. Each season presents unique challenges and opportunities for roof upkeep. In winter, for instance, accumulating snow and ice can weigh heavily on roofs and may lead to water pooling if not addressed in a timely manner. The risk of ice dams forming along the roof edges can also require careful attention to prevent leaks and potential structural damage. Therefore, it is advisable for facility managers to inspect roofs after major winter weather events to remove snow or ice build-up and ensure that drainage systems are functioning correctly.

Spring is often a perfect time for a thorough roof cleaning and maintenance check. As temperatures rise and snow melts, debris that has accumulated over winter can be washed away. Additionally, this season allows for assessments of any damage that may have occurred during colder months. Regular inspections during spring can help facility managers identify issues such as cracks, missing shingles, or damaged flashing that may have gone unnoticed. Cleaning is essential during this time, not only to remove debris but also to prevent the proliferation of moss, algae, and other growths that thrive in warmer wet conditions.

Summer brings not only heat but also increased moisture levels during thunderstorms. Summer storms can lead to an influx of leaves, branches, and other debris onto roofs. Regular cleaning during this season is vital to ensure effective drainage and to minimize the chances of standing water, which can lead to leaks or mold growth. Furthermore, the hot summer sun can dry out roofing materials, leading to brittleness and reduced integrity. Therefore, summer maintenance often includes inspections for wear and ensuring that roofs are adequately equipped to handle the heat.

Finally, autumn is a significant time for roof maintenance as trees shed their leaves. Clogged gutters and downspouts from fallen leaves can directly impact roof performance, leading to water pooling and potential damage. Scheduling cleaning in the fall can greatly reduce the risk of these issues by ensuring that all debris is cleared before winter weather arrives. Impact of Environmental Conditions on Roof Cleaning Needs

The condition of a commercial roof is significantly influenced by environmental factors, which can dictate how often it needs to be cleaned. Common environmental conditions include the geographic location of the building, local climate patterns, air pollution levels, and proximity to vegetation. For instance, roofs located in areas with high humidity or frequent rainfall may experience the growth of algae, moss, and mildew more quickly, prompting more regular cleaning to prevent deterioration. In contrast, roofs in arid climates may accumulate dust and debris, necessitating periodic cleaning to maintain their structural integrity.

Air pollution, often prevalent in urban areas, also plays a critical role. Chemical pollutants can corrode roofing materials over time, leading to a shorter lifespan for the roof if not properly maintained. In locations with heavy industry or vehicular traffic, roofs can accumulate soot, smog, and other particulates, which can trap moisture and create an environment conducive to fungal growth. This reduction in airflow and increase in moisture can cause materials to weaken, increasing the need for cleaning and preventive maintenance.

Furthermore, surrounding vegetation can also impact cleaning requirements. If a commercial roof is bordered by trees, it may collect significant amounts of leaves and organic debris, which can lead to blocked drainage systems and promote water pooling, highlighting the necessity for more frequent maintenance. Regular cleaning ensures that roof drains are clear and that the roofing materials are not compromised by organic growth or moisture retention.

Cost-Benefit Analysis of Regular Roof Cleaning

Regular roof cleaning for commercial buildings offers a range of benefits that can outweigh the initial costs associated with the process. When considering the expenses involved in maintaining a commercial roof, property owners and managers must evaluate not only the immediate financial outlay for cleaning services but also the long-term gains associated with implementing a consistent cleaning schedule. A thorough cost-benefit analysis can help inform decisions about roof maintenance and establish the value of investing in roof cleaning.

From a cost perspective, the initial expenses of roof cleaning can seem significant. However, the potential savings achieved through preventative maintenance can be substantial. Accumulated debris, moss, or algae can lead to accelerated wear and tear on roofing materials, potentially resulting in costly repairs or replacements down the line. By regularly cleaning the roof, property owners can extend the lifespan of the roofing system, reducing the frequency and need for large-scale repairs. Moreover, a clean roof can enhance the building’s insulation properties, leading to potential savings on heating and cooling costs.

Additionally, maintaining a clean roof can improve the overall aesthetic appeal of a commercial property, which is important for businesses that rely on visual impressions for customer attraction. A well-maintained roof reflects positively on the entire property and can contribute to increased property value.
